6 Basic Level
The
Basic
menu provides access to the tunable control settings and setpoint
values.
Loop 1 (2) Setpoints
Local
S
etpoint 1 (4)
The local setpoint value required. If this value is adjusted in the
Operator Level
(see page 23)
its value in here is also updated.
R
S
P Ratio
If the remote (external) setpoint is selected the control setpoint value is (ratio x remote
setpoint input) + bias.
Note
. This parameter is available only if the template selected has remote setpoint or if a
ratio controller / station template is selected – see page 94.
R
S
P Bias
Sets the remote setpoint bias in engineering units.
Note
. This parameter is available only if template selected has remote setpoint or ratio.
Ramp Mode
The ramping setpoint facility can be used to prevent a large disturbance to the control
output when the setpoint value is changed. The rate set applies to both the local and the
remote setpoints.
Ramp Rate
Sets the ramp rate required in engineering units / hour.
